Best time to go to Orlando
Carefully consider your dates before securing your flight from Preston-Glenn Field Airport to Orlando. The city buzzes in high season, but hotel prices are often higher and major attractions can be busy. Visit Orlando in low season if you like a more relaxed vibe.
The warmest month in Orlando is July, with temperatures ranging between 23ºC (73ºF) and 34ºC (93ºF). Book your Preston-Glenn Field Airport to Orlando flight ticket then if that's your idea of comfortable weather.
January sees average temperatures of between 7ºC (45ºF) and 23ºC (73ºF). Search for a cheap ticket from LYH to Orlando around that time if you like travelling in cooler conditions.
